API 網關工具
- API 網關工具:加密期貨交易初學者指南
簡介
在加密貨幣期貨交易領域,自動化交易和高效的數據管理變得越來越重要。API(應用程式編程接口)允許交易者和開發者與交易所進行直接交互,自動化交易策略、獲取市場數據並管理賬戶。然而,直接使用交易所API可能存在複雜性、安全風險和維護負擔。API 網關工具應運而生,它們作為API與交易者/開發者之間的中介,簡化了交互過程,並提供了額外的安全性和功能。本文將深入探討API網關工具,幫助初學者理解其作用、優勢、選擇標準以及常用工具。
什麼是API以及為什麼需要API網關?
首先,我們需要理解什麼是API。API本質上是一組規則和協議,允許不同的應用程式相互通信。在加密貨幣交易所中,API允許交易者執行諸如下單、查詢賬戶餘額、獲取歷史交易數據等操作。
直接使用交易所API面臨諸多挑戰:
- **複雜性:** 不同的交易所擁有不同的API結構和認證方式,需要開發者針對每個交易所編寫不同的代碼。
- **安全風險:** 直接暴露API密鑰會增加安全風險,可能導致賬戶被盜用。
- **維護負擔:** 交易所API可能會發生變化,需要開發者及時更新代碼以保持兼容性。
- **限流和速率限制:** 交易所通常會限制API調用的頻率,以防止濫用。
- **數據格式轉換:** 不同交易所可能使用不同的數據格式,需要進行數據轉換。
API網關工具應運而生,旨在解決這些問題。它像一個反向代理,位於API和客戶端之間,提供以下功能:
- **統一API接口:** 將多個交易所的API整合到一個統一的接口中,簡化開發流程。
- **安全管理:** 集中管理API密鑰、權限控制和訪問日誌,提高安全性。
- **速率限制和流量控制:** 防止API濫用,確保系統穩定。
- **數據轉換和格式化:** 將不同交易所的數據格式轉換為統一的格式,方便數據分析。
- **監控和分析:** 監控API使用情況,提供性能分析和錯誤報告。
- **緩存:** 緩存常用數據,減少API調用次數,提高響應速度。
- **故障轉移:** 在交易所API出現故障時,自動切換到備用交易所。
API網關工具的關鍵特性
在選擇API網關工具時,需要考慮以下關鍵特性:
- **支持的交易所:** 確保API網關支持您需要交易的交易所,例如幣安、OKX、Bybit、Bitget等。
- **安全性:** 強大的安全機制,例如API密鑰加密、多因素認證和訪問控制。
- **延遲:** 低延遲的API響應速度對於高頻交易至關重要。
- **可靠性:** 高可用性和容錯能力,確保系統穩定運行。
- **可擴展性:** 能夠處理大量的API調用。
- **易用性:** 友好的用戶界面和完善的文檔。
- **數據處理能力:** 能夠處理和轉換各種數據格式,例如JSON、CSV等。
- **監控和日誌記錄:** 詳細的API使用情況監控和日誌記錄功能。
- **費用:** 考慮API網關的定價模式和費用。
- **技術支持:** 提供及時的技術支持。
常用API網關工具
以下是一些常用的API網關工具:
工具名稱 | 描述 | 優勢 | 劣勢 | 適用場景 |
---|---|---|---|---|
Tapestry | 開源的API網關,專注於加密貨幣交易。 | 免費、開源、可定製、支持多種交易所。 | 部署和維護需要一定的技術能力。 | 適合有技術能力的開發者和機構。 |
Kaiko | 提供全面的加密貨幣市場數據和API網關服務。 | 數據質量高、覆蓋範圍廣、提供多種數據產品。 | 費用較高。 | 適合需要高質量市場數據的交易者和機構。 |
Cryptohopper | 集成了API網關、自動交易機械人和策略回測功能。 | 一站式平台、易於使用、提供多種交易策略。 | 費用較高、自定義程度較低。 | 適合初學者和希望快速部署交易策略的交易者。 |
Altrady | 提供API網關、交易自動化和高級圖表工具。 | 支持多種交易所、提供高級圖表工具、支持多種交易策略。 | 費用較高、用戶界面相對複雜。 | 適合有一定經驗的交易者和希望進行高級交易的交易者。 |
3Commas | 類似於Cryptohopper,提供自動交易機械人和API網關服務。 | 易於使用、提供多種交易策略、社區活躍。 | 費用較高、自定義程度較低。 | 適合初學者和希望快速部署交易策略的交易者。 |
- 詳細介紹:**
- **Tapestry:** 這是一個開源項目,允許開發者構建自己的加密貨幣交易基礎設施。它提供靈活的API管理功能,但需要一定的技術知識才能部署和維護。
- **Kaiko:** Kaiko專注於提供高質量的加密貨幣市場數據,其API網關服務能夠幫助交易者獲取實時的市場信息,並執行交易。
- **Cryptohopper & 3Commas:** 這兩個平台都提供了易於使用的API網關和自動交易機械人,適合初學者和希望快速部署交易策略的交易者。它們通常提供預定義的交易策略,並允許用戶自定義參數。
- **Altrady:** Altrady 提供了更高級的交易工具和API管理功能,適合有一定經驗的交易者和希望進行高級交易的交易者。
如何選擇合適的API網關工具?
選擇合適的API網關工具取決於您的具體需求和技術水平。以下是一些建議:
- **初學者:** 如果您是初學者,建議選擇易於使用、提供預定義交易策略的平台,例如Cryptohopper或3Commas。
- **有技術能力的開發者:** 如果您具有一定的技術能力,並且希望完全掌控API管理,可以選擇開源的Tapestry。
- **需要高質量市場數據:** 如果您需要高質量的市場數據,可以選擇Kaiko。
- **需要高級交易工具:** 如果您需要高級的交易工具和API管理功能,可以選擇Altrady。
在選擇之前,建議您試用不同的API網關工具,並根據您的實際需求進行評估。
API網關工具在交易策略中的應用
API網關工具可以應用於各種交易策略,例如:
- **套利交易:** 利用不同交易所之間的價格差異進行套利交易。API網關可以幫助您快速獲取不同交易所的價格數據,並執行交易。套利交易策略
- **做市策略:** 在訂單簿中提供買賣報價,賺取買賣價差。API網關可以幫助您自動化做市流程,並管理訂單。做市商策略
- **趨勢跟蹤策略:** 根據市場趨勢進行交易。API網關可以幫助您獲取歷史交易數據,並執行交易。趨勢跟蹤策略
- **均值回歸策略:** 當價格偏離均值時進行交易。API網關可以幫助您計算均值和標準差,並執行交易。均值回歸策略
- **量化交易:** 基於數學模型和統計分析進行交易。API網關可以幫助您獲取數據、執行策略和管理風險。量化交易入門
API網關與風險管理
API網關在風險管理方面也發揮着重要作用。通過API網關,您可以:
- **設置交易限制:** 限制單筆交易的金額、數量和頻率。
- **監控賬戶餘額:** 實時監控賬戶餘額,防止過度交易。
- **設置止損和止盈:** 自動執行止損和止盈訂單,控制風險。止損策略
- **監控API使用情況:** 監控API使用情況,及時發現異常行為。
- **實施白名單和黑名單:** 限制API的訪問權限,防止未經授權的訪問。
未來發展趨勢
API網關工具的未來發展趨勢包括:
- **更強大的安全功能:** 隨着網絡安全威脅的增加,API網關將提供更強大的安全功能,例如零信任安全和區塊鏈技術。
- **更智能的自動化:** API網關將集成人工智能和機器學習技術,提供更智能的自動化功能,例如自動交易策略優化和風險管理。
- **更廣泛的連接性:** API網關將支持更多的交易所和數據源,提供更廣泛的連接性。
- **更簡化的用戶體驗:** API網關將提供更簡化的用戶體驗,降低使用門檻。
- **DeFi 集成:** API網關將更深入地集成去中心化金融(DeFi)協議,為交易者提供更多的交易機會。
總結
API網關工具是加密期貨交易者和開發者不可或缺的工具。它們簡化了API交互過程,提供了額外的安全性和功能,並幫助交易者自動化交易策略和管理風險。通過選擇合適的API網關工具,您可以提高交易效率、降低風險並獲得更大的收益。 深入了解 技術分析、交易量分析 和 市場情緒分析 可以進一步提升您的交易水平。
加密貨幣交易所 交易機械人 API密鑰管理 安全交易實踐 交易所API文檔
推薦的期貨交易平台
平台 | 期貨特點 | 註冊 |
---|---|---|
Binance Futures | 槓桿高達125倍,USDⓈ-M 合約 | 立即註冊 |
Bybit Futures | 永續反向合約 | 開始交易 |
BingX Futures | 跟單交易 | 加入BingX |
Bitget Futures | USDT 保證合約 | 開戶 |
BitMEX | 加密貨幣交易平台,槓桿高達100倍 | BitMEX |
加入社區
關注 Telegram 頻道 @strategybin 獲取更多信息。 最佳盈利平台 – 立即註冊.
參與我們的社區
關注 Telegram 頻道 @cryptofuturestrading 獲取分析、免費信號等更多信息!